1Board: Nokia RX-51 aka N900 2 3This board definition results in a u-boot.bin which can be chainloaded 4from NOLO in qemu or on a real N900. It does very little hardware config 5because NOLO has already configured the board. Only needed is enabling 6internal eMMC memory via twl4030 regulator which is not enabled by NOLO. 7 8NOLO is expecting a kernel image and will treat any image it finds in 9onenand as such. This u-boot is intended to be flashed to the N900 like 10a kernel. In order to transparently boot the original kernel, it will be 11appended to u-boot.bin at 0x40000. NOLO will load the entire image into 12(random) memory and execute u-boot, which saves hw revision, boot reason 13and boot mode ATAGs set by NOLO. Then the bootscripts will attempt to load 14uImage, zImage or boot.scr from a fat or ext2/3/4 filesystem on external 15SD card or internal eMMC memory. If this fails or keyboard is closed then 16the appended kernel image will be booted using some generated and some 17stored ATAGs (see boot order). 18 19For generating combined image of u-boot and kernel (either in uImage or zImage 20format) there is a simple script called u-boot-gen-combined. It is available in 21following repository: 22 23 https://github.com/pali/u-boot-maemo 24 25There is support for hardware watchdog. Hardware watchdog is started by 26NOLO so u-boot must kick watchdog to prevent reboot device (but not very 27often, max every 2 seconds). There is also support for framebuffer display 28output with ANSI escape codes and the N900 HW keyboard input. 29 30When U-Boot is starting it enable IBE bit in Auxiliary Control Register, 31which is needed for Thumb-2 ISA support. It is workaround for errata 430973. 32 33Default boot order: 34 35 * 0. if keyboard is closed boot automatically attached kernel image 36 * 1. try boot from external SD card 37 * 2. try boot from internal eMMC memory 38 * 3. try boot from attached kernel image 39 40Boot from SD or eMMC in this order: 41 42 * 1. 43 * 1.1 find boot.scr on first fat partition 44 * 1.2 find uImage on first fat partition 45 * 1.3 find zImage on first fat partition 46 * 1.4 same order for 2. - 4. fat partition 47 * 2. same as 1. but for ext2/3 partition 48 * 3. same as 1. but for ext4 partition 49 50 51Available additional commands/variables: 52 53 * run sdboot - Boot from external SD card (see boot order) 54 * run emmcboot - Boot from internal eMMC memory (see boot order) 55 * run attachboot - Boot attached kernel image (attached to U-Boot binary) 56 57 * run scriptload - Load boot script ${mmcscriptfile} 58 * run scriptboot - Run loaded boot script 59 * run kernload - Load kernel image ${mmckernfile} 60 * run initrdload - Load initrd image ${mmcinitrdfile} 61 * run kernboot - Boot loaded kernel image 62 * run kerninitrdboot - Boot loaded kernel image with loaded initrd image 63 64 * run trymmcscriptboot - Try to load and boot script ${mmcscriptfile} 65 * run trymmckernboot - Try to load and boot kernel image ${mmckernfile} 66 * run trymmckerninitrdboot - Try to load and boot kernel image ${mmckernfile} 67 with initrd image ${mmcinitrdfile} 68 69Additional variables for loading files from mmc: 70 71 * mmc ${mmcnum} (0 - external, 1 - internal) 72 * partition number ${mmcpart} (1 - 4) 73 * parition type ${mmctype} (fat, ext2, ext4) 74 75Additional variables for booting kernel: 76 77 * setup_omap_atag - Add OMAP table into atags structure (needs maemo kernel) 78 * setup_console_atag - Enable serial console in OMAP table 79 * setup_boot_reason_atag - Change boot reason in OMAP table 80 * setup_boot_mode_atag - Change boot mode in OMAP table 81 82 Variable setup_omap_atag is automatically set when booting attached kernel. 83 When variable setup_omap_atag is set, variable setup_console_atag is unset 84 and u-boot standard output is set to serial then setup_console_atag is 85 automatically set to 1. So output from Maemo kernel would go to serial port. 86 87UBIFS support: 88 89 UBIFS support is disabled, because U-Boot image is too big and cannot be 90 flashed with attached zImage to RX-51 kernel nand area. For enabling UBIFS 91 support add following lines into file configs/nokia_rx51_defconfig 92 93 CONFIG_CMD_UBI=y 94 CONFIG_CMD_UBIFS=y 95 CONFIG_MTD_UBI_FASTMAP=y 96 CONFIG_MTD_UBI_FASTMAP_AUTOCONVERT=1 97
